Background Information
KIAA1033, also named as WASH-interacting protein and SWIP, is a component of WASH complex. The WASH complex plays a key role in the fission of tubules that serve as transport intermediates during endosome sorting. KIAA1033 has two isoforms with MW 100 kDa and 136 kDa.
